PRODUCT FEATURES
What does it protect ? The CONTENTS and INTERIOR FITTINGS of the caravan The PARKED CARAVAN The COUPLED COMBINATION of tow vehicle and caravan The OWNERS of the caravan (panic alarm) Any POSSESSIONS kept in the awning or around the caravan, for example, wheel clamps, hitch locks, mountain bikes, large gas cylinders etc. (Requires optional REMOTE SENSOR/S) How does it protect ? The CONTENTS are protected by a PIR detector mounted inside the caravan. Unlike most caravan alarms CONCEPT KEL sounds the siren as soon as an intruder is detected. This makes life very difficult for the snatch thief. The PARKED caravan is protected two ways. A sensor mounted underneath the caravan and close to a rear steady detects rotation of the leg winder. It doesn't matter what the angle of the leg is, the alarm is triggered by rotation of the leg winder. Strong winds moving the caravan will not set the alarm off. The alarm is connected to the caravan's road lighting wiring. When a thief hitches up and inserts the 12N (road lighting) plug, the alarm sounds immediately. Should a thief drive off with the 12N plug inserted, every time the footbrake is used the siren will sound. The COUPLED combination is protected by the 12N plug (see above). If a thief unplugs the 12N plug the siren sounds. If a thief drives off in your tow vehicle with the caravan still coupled, every time the footbrake is used the siren will sound. The OWNERS of the caravan can sound the siren using the PANIC alarm feature, switch the alarm on then press both buttons together. POSSESSIONS can be protected by REMOTE SENSORS (optional extras) which send a radio signal to the alarm. These are powered by a PP3 battery and can be attached to mountain bikes, large gas cylinders or to wheel clamps for additional protection against theft of the caravan.
